The basking spot for your dragons is too cold. Dragons need the basking spot temperature of 105-110 to properly digest their food, as they must raise their temperature to 100.
Walnut shells are a horrible substrate to use, because if swallowed, they can cut the insides of the bearded dragon, even though they may feel safe to run your fingers over them in your hand. They cause impaction, and most likely death.
Even a bare tank bottom is better then that substrate.
I recommend non-adhesive shelf liner.
